TikTok for Developers
Introducing Widgets - App Development on TikTok Shop has never been easier
by The TikTok Shop Team
Developer products
TikTok Shop

At TikTok, we strive to enhance user experiences and empower developers to create seamless interactions within our ecosystem. As part of this, we're excited to share that Widgets are now part of our developer toolkit. It's a powerful addition that helps streamline app development on TikTok Shop like never before.


What are Widgets?

Widgets are dynamic page blocks that combine TikTok Shop-based API functionalities with intuitive UI interfaces. Unlike APIs, Widgets come bundled with a user-friendly interface, eliminating the need for developers to build UI components from scratch.


Why are Widgets useful?

  1. Maintain workflows in your app: There are some unique capabilities in TikTok Shop where a seller might have to complete a workflow in Seller Center. With widgets, developers can now expose those actions in their apps so sellers can complete their step in one place.
  2. Information at the right time in the right place: Widgets also allow developers to showcase information in their apps that was previously only accessible in TikTok Shop Seller Center. Examples include platform-related notifications, violations information, and 4PL-related orders.
  3. Lower development effort: Developers can use Widgets' pre-built UI components to reduce development cost. They also allow developers to tap into new actions and information that are not yet supported by APIs.



What Widgets are available?

Let's dive into some of our available Widgets:

  1. Warehouse Widget: This Widget allows sellers to set up warehouse information directly within the app. From warehouse addresses to sales ranges, sellers can streamline product listing processes without navigating to the Seller Center.
  2. Shipping Template Widget: This Widget allows sellers to set shipping templates. Whether shipping independently or through a third-party logistics provider, sellers can avoid listing failures by configuring shipping templates within a third-party app.
  3. Product Optimizer Widget: Leveraging AI-powered recommendations, this Widget gives sellers the tools to optimize their product descriptions for visibility and performance on TikTok Shop.
  4. Orders by TikTok Shipping (4PL) Widget: This Widget makes it easier for sellers using TikTok Shipping (4PL) to manage their orders. Batch order processing, label creation, and more can be completed with this Widget without requiring the seller to leave the app environment.


Widgets offer an easy way for developers to improve the TikTok Shop seller experience. We're excited to see how our developer community leverages Widgets to update and create new app experiences!


If you are already developing on TikTok Shop Partner Center, reach out to our support team for access. Otherwise, join our Webinar to learn more.


Want to learn more?

  • Learn about how to access Widgets: Register for our upcoming webinar "Your Guide to Widgets"—happening on May 23rd, 2024.
  • Stay connected: Sign up for emails to get access to future developer events and TikTok Shop community resources.
  • Become a TikTok Shop developer: Join TikTok Shop Partner Center to explore our APIs, request Widget access, and start building.
Share this article
Discover more
Using Local Differential Privacy Frequency Estimation for Secure Data CollectionLearn about our Locally Differential Privacy (LDP) frequency estimation protocol that collects user's local data with strong privacy protection.
Research
Privacy
Privacy-Preserving Data Collection from Unknown DomainsOur new protocol to collect unknown domain data combines Differential Privacy and cryptography, and has strong privacy guarantees and reduced computational costs.
Research
Privacy
Advancing Privacy and Security: 2024 Research PublicationsTikTok's research efforts in 2024 highlighted four key privacy and security advancements: differential privacy, secure computing, Private Set Intersection (PSI), and AI hallucination.
Privacy
Want to stay in the loop?Subscribe to our mailing list to be the first to know about future blog posts!
By providing your email address and subscribing, you consent to TikTok sending you email notifications whenever a new article is posted on our blogs. You may opt out at any time using the unsubscribe link in each email. Read our full Privacy Policy for more information.